HTML: Diferenzas entre revisións

Contido eliminado Contido engadido
Xoacas (conversa | contribucións)
Lixo
Xoacas (conversa | contribucións)
Incorporados contidos de Html
Liña 1:
[[Ficheiro:Html-source-code3.png|framed|Código fonte dun documento HTML.]]
{{Lixo|Fundido con [[HTML]]}}
EnA [[informática]],'''Linguaxe ode Etiquetaxe de HiperTexto''' ('''HTML''' ou '''''HyperText Markup Language''''', en inglés) é unha [[linguaxe de etiquetadoinformática]] deseñada para a creación decrear [[páxina web|páxinas web]] con [[hipertexto]] e calquera outra información que se queira amosar no [[navegador de internet]]. HTML úsase para estruturarseren informaciónvistas (definindo certas secuencias ou cadeas coma epígrafes, parágrafos, listas, etc.) e pode usarse en certa medida para describir a aparencia ecun [[semánticanavegador]] dun documento. A estrutura gramatical do HTML é o HTML [[DTD]], que se creou utilizando a sintaxe [[SGML]].
 
==Historia==
Definiuno inicialmente [[Tim Berners-Lee]] e logo desenvolveuno o [[IETF]]: agora conta cun estándar internacional ([[ISO]]/[[IEC]] 15445:2000), tralo cal as especificacións ulteriores están delimitadas polo [[World Wide Web Consortium]] (W3C).
O HTML foi desenvolvido orixinalmente por [[Tim Berners-Lee]] cando traballaba no [[CERN]] e procuraba un medio de intercambio de información que facilitase a publicación de textos facilmente referenciábeis. O [[protocolo (informática)|protocolo]] que creou converteuse na [[World Wide Web]] (www, Rede Mundial) e popularizouse co navegador [[Mosaic]], realizado no [[NCSA]]. Durante a década de [[1990]], floreceu co medre explosivo da Rede. Durante este tempo, a HTML expandiuse a moitos ámbitos.
 
As primeiras versións de HTML definíronse con regras sintácticas moi laxas, que axudaron á súa adopción por parte dos non iniciados coa publicación na [[Rede informática|rede]]. Os navegadores de internet normalmente deducían o significado en certas seccións e amosaban a [[páxina web]]. Co tempo, a tendencia dos normativas oficiais foi a de crear unha sintaxe da linguaxe cada vez máis estrita, a pesares de que os navegadores continúan amosando páxinas que aínda están moi afastadas do HTML válido.
 
==Características==
A evolución do HTML continúa con [[XHTML]], o seu análogo baseado en [[XML]], que aplica a sintaxe menos ambigua do XML a HTML para facelo máis doado de procesar e manter. Mentres continúa publicando recomendacións para HTML 4.01, agora o W3C centra a súa atención no desenvolvemento deste XHTML, sucesor de HTML.
A característica máis notoria do HTML é a presenza de vínculos que permiten "saltar" a outros lugares desa páxina ou doutras. Xorde da base [[SGML]] para converterse nunha linguaxe estrutural de contidos hipertextuais.
 
A evolución da informática no tempo e o uso masivo por parte dos internautas propiciou que houbese varias variantes da linguaxe ao longo do tempo, con propósitos específicos que van dende a incidencia semántica e interpretabilidade dos contidos, ata a [[hipermedia]] que fundamenta a interacción efectiva cos usuarios, pasando por etapas intermedias de gran inestabilidade ligadas a dominancia no competitivo mercado de navegadores.
 
Actualmente se atopa nun estado bastante estable, dende que a finais dos noventa se especificase a súa integración na sintaxe de [[XML]], mantendo unha política de forte compromiso con semánticas simples no que é o entorno actual da vertente social da rede, con maior incidencia en contidos textuais e relacionais entre individuos que en autoprodución multimedia, e evolucionando cara a varias vertentes, por un lado de aplicacións web ([[HTML 5]]) e por outro incidindo na difusión da actual [[web social]] ([[XHTML 2]]). A estabilidade da Rede depende de que os autores de páxinas e as empresas comparten as mesmas convencións de HTML.
 
O HTML permite:
* Publicar [[documento]]s [[en liña]] con títulos, texto, tabelas, listas, fotos, etc.
* Recuperar información en liña a través de [[vínculo]]s de [[hipertexto]] con só facer clic cun botón.
* Deseñar [[formulario]]s para levar a cabo [[transacción]]s en [[servidor]]es remotos, para usar na procura de información, para facer reservas, pedir produtos, etc.
* Incluír [[folla de cálculo|follas de cálculo]], vídeo clips, sons e outras [[aplicación]]s directamente nos documentos.
 
Debido a que as páxinas web poden ser mostradas en multitude de modos distintos (navegadores de só texto, distintas configuracións de pantalla, papel, audio, etc.), o seu deseño céntrase na presentación da información mediante estilos de texto, tabelas, etc. que cada navegador decide como interpretar. A HTML non instrúe sobre, por exemplo, onde se debería colocar unha imaxe; isto déixase ao navegador, que interpreta as intencións do autor. Actualmente, a HTML compleméntase con outras linguaxes, como as [[folla de estilo|follas de estilo]], que si explicitan como se mostra o contido, e outras [[script|linguaxes de guión]], como [[javascript]] ou [[PHP]], que realizan distintas operacións.
 
A HTML é un padrón internacional ([[ISO]]/[[IEC]] 15445:2000) e é mantida polo [[World Wide Web Consortium]] (W3C, Consorcio da Rede Mundial). Trátase dunha linguaxe non de [[linguaxe de programación|programación]], senón de etiquetaxe: está orientada cara a presentación de documentos de texto con formatos. Estes documentos de textos créanse cun [[editor]] e almacénanse nun [[ficheiro]] de texto coa [[extensión]] ".html" ou ".htm". Os ficheiros residen nun [[servidor web]] que os envía mediante o [[protocolo (informática)|protocolo]] [[HTTP]] cando o solicita un computador.
 
== Véxase tamén ==
=== Outros artigos ===
* [[Internet]]
* [[Navegador]]
* [[World Wide Web Consortium|W3C]]
* [[WWW]]
* [[XML]]
 
=== Ligazóns externas ===
* [http://www.galizaweb.net/html4/cover.html Tradución galega da especificación da versión HTML 4.01]
 
[[Categoría:Internet]]
[[Categoría:Linguaxes de interface]]
 
[[af:HTML]]
[[als:HTML]]
[[an:HTML]]
[[ar:لغة رقم النص الفائق]]
[[az:HTML]]
[[bar:HTML]]
[[bat-smg:HTML]]
[[be-x-old:HTML]]
[[bg:HTML]]
[[bn:হাইপার টেক্সট মার্ক আপ ল্যাঙ্গুয়েজ]]
[[br:HTML]]
[[bs:HTML]]
[[ca:Hyper Text Markup Language]]
[[co:HTML]]
[[cs:HyperText Markup Language]]
[[cv:HTML]]
[[cy:HTML]]
[[da:HTML]]
[[de:Hypertext Markup Language]]
[[el:HTML]]
[[en:HTML]]
[[eo:HTML]]
[[es:HTML]]
[[et:HTML]]
[[eu:HTML]]
[[fa:اچ‌تی‌ام‌ال]]
[[fi:HTML]]
[[fo:HTML]]
[[fr:Hypertext Markup Language]]
[[fur:HTML]]
[[fy:HTML]]
[[ga:HTML]]
[[he:HTML]]
[[hi:एच.टी.एम.एल.]]
[[hr:HTML]]
[[hsb:HTML]]
[[hu:HTML]]
[[hy:HTML]]
[[ia:HTML]]
[[id:Hypertext markup language]]
[[is:HTML]]
[[it:HTML]]
[[ja:HyperText Markup Language]]
[[ka:ჰიპერტექსტური მარკირების ენა]]
[[kaa:HTML]]
[[kk:HTML]]
[[km:HTML]]
[[ko:HTML]]
[[ku:HTML]]
[[lb:Hypertext Markup Language]]
[[lmo:HTML]]
[[lt:HTML]]
[[lv:HTML]]
[[mk:HTML]]
[[ml:എച്.ടി.എം.എൽ.]]
[[mn:HTML]]
[[mr:एच.टी.एम.एल.]]
[[ms:HTML]]
[[new:एच टी एम् एल्]]
[[nl:HyperText Markup Language]]
[[nn:HTML]]
[[no:HTML]]
[[pl:HTML]]
[[pt:HTML]]
[[ro:HyperText Markup Language]]
[[ru:HTML]]
[[sh:HTML]]
[[simple:HTML]]
[[sk:Hypertext markup language]]
[[sl:HTML]]
[[sq:HTML]]
[[sr:HTML]]
[[sv:HTML]]
[[sw:HTML]]
[[ta:எச்.டி.எம்.எல்]]
[[te:HTML]]
[[tg:HTML]]
[[th:HTML]]
[[tl:HTML]]
[[tr:HTML]]
[[uk:HTML]]
[[ur:وراۓمتن زبان تدوین]]
[[uz:HTML]]
[[vi:HTML]]
[[yi:HTML]]
[[zh:HTML]]
[[zh-yue:HTML]]